Jasmine Becket-Griffith is a traditional acrylic painter, combining elements of realism with fantasy and the surreal. Historical and spiritual references are intertwined with fairytales and the beauty of nature. Her trademark liquid eyed maidens evoke a wide range of emotions and responses to the surrounding imagery. It is her goal to bring a bit of magic and mystery to the mundane world with every painting! All our patterns are the highest quality that can be created for the given size and color constraints. Occasionally this results in some threads that are only used for a handful of stitches in a pattern but we include them because they are the best matches for those colors. You can stitch them as-is or you can use your own judgement and may decide to replace them with another similar color that is already used elsewhere in the pattern. Image Sizes

Patterns can be used with any canvas type, all that will change is the physical dimensions of the completed image. To allow for mounting a cross-stitch piece in a frame we recommend a canvas size with at least 3 additional inches on each edge.

Completed Image Size Suggested Canvas Size
Canvas Type Width Height Width Height
11 Count Aida 24 ¾" 32 ¾" 30 ¾" 38 ¾"
14 Count Aida 19 ½" 25 ¾" 25 ½" 31 ¾"
16 Count Aida 17" 22 ½" 23" 28 ½"
18 Count Aida 15" 20" 21" 26"
20 Count Aida 13 ½" 18" 19 ½" 24"
22 Count Hardanger 12 ¼" 16 ¼" 18 ¼" 22 ¼"
25 Count Evenweave 11" 14 ½" 17" 20 ½"
28 Count Evenweave 9 ¾" 12 ¾" 15 ¾" 18 ¾"
32 Count Evenweave 8 ½" 11 ¼" 14 ½" 17 ¼"
